c/s 580c45869 "Call arch_domain_create() as early as possible in
domain_create()" overlooked the fact that ARM uses is_hardware_domain() in at
least two places during arch_domain_create().

The bug manifests as:

   (XEN) Freed 292kB init memory.
   (XEN) traps.c:2017:d0v0 HSR=0x938c0007 pc=0xc0639d08 gva=0xe0800004 
gpa=0x00000010481004

when dom0 tries to use the vuart.  Judging by other uses of
is_hardware_domain(), I expect the x86 PVH dom0 boot is similarly broken.

Reposition the code which sets up hardware_domain so that the
is_hardware_domain() predicate works correctly all the way through domain
creation.

While moving it, leave a related comment explaining the positioning of the
is_priv assignment, which in hindsight should have been part of c/s ef765ec98
when exactly the same problem was discovered for the is_control_domain()
predicate.
